What companies run services between Florence Airport (FLR), Italy and Italiana Hotels Florence, Italy?

Autolinee Toscane operates a bus from Firenze T2 Guidoni to Olanda Europa every 15 minutes. Tickets cost €1–3 and the journey takes 53 min.
